COMQuest Research

Methodology

About the Study• The Corporate Reputations Ratings Service is a shared-cost corporate image study that is conducted

on an annual basis among senior business executives in 15 countries – a total of 1,500 interviews in the Americas, Asia Pacific and Europe.

• The fieldwork for this study, the initial wave of this program, was conducted in November-December 2002.

Number of InterviewsA total of 100 interviews were conducted in each country; an overall total of 1,500 interviews.

Data CollectionWith the exception of China, interviewing was conducted using a CATI (computer-assisted telephone

interviewing) methodology. Interviews in China were conducted in-person. All interviews were conducted in the respondent’s native language.
